Version 3.3.23

What's new in this release?

  • Automatic content sharing
  • As an administrator, if you select the “Preview Local Content” setting on the Admin UI, users will automatically see content shared locally whenever a content share device is connected to their VidyoRoom system.
  • If a content share device is connected but users don’t want to see the content, they can simply press the “Share” button on their VidyoRemote 3.
  • feIf no content share device is connected, the “Share” button is disabled, thereby preventing users from inadvertently sharing a blank screen.ature
  • Support for additional peripherals
  • The Logitech PTZ Pro 2, an HD 1080p camera with enhanced pan, tilt, and zoom.
  • The Yamaha YVC-300, a USB conference speakerphone perfect for small-sized meetings with four to six people.
  • In addition, the Icron Technologies Rover 1850 85-meter extender has been qualified for use as a USB 2.0 extender with the Yamaha YVC-300.
  • The Logitech GROUP systems camera now includes a number of hardware enhancements, such as improved camera movement and cleaner images while zooming.
  • Important bug fixes
  • In this release, we've addressed some important issues to improve usability and reliability.
  • System updates
  • For added security and stability, updates for multiple third-party packages and libraries are included as part of this release.

Resolved issues

The following table lists the issues we have resolved in VidyoConnect Room and VidyoRoom version 3.3.23 (841) - resolved issues

VidyoConnect Room and VidyoRoom version 3.3.23 (841) - resolved issues

Key

Summary

GS-4275, GS-4254, and VRMT-736

Administrators can select the “Preview Local Content” setting on the Admin UI to enable users to automatically see content shared locally whenever a content share device is connected to their VidyoRoom system. When users don’t want to see the content, they can simply press the “Share” button on their VidyoRemote 3 to turn off this setting for the current call. If no content share device is connected, the “Share” button is disabled, thereby preventing users from inadvertently seeing a green screen.

GS-4260

When the VidyoRoom application sorts participants by name, certain Turkish characters no longer cause the application to crash.

GS-4256

An issue that occasionally caused the remote participant’s received audio to briefly cut out has been resolved.

GS-4246 and GS-4147

VidyoRoom users can now join a call via a guest link even when the room has a PIN.

GS-4241 and GS-4202

The Call In Progress (CIP) indicator setting, which was unintentionally not being saved in the config file in the previous releases of version 3.3.21, is now being saved again.

When it was not being saved, VidyoRoom systems came up with the default settings after each reboot and began showing CIP when there was no remote or local video to display. This issue no longer occurs in version 3.3.21 Rev C.

GS-4224

The Intel Management Engine Critical Firmware Update (Intel-SA-00086) security vulnerability has been addressed for VidyoRoom HD-3 systems.

GS-4222

Private certificates no longer get unexpectedly deleted when a VidyoRoom system upgrade occurs.

GS-4212

Deleting or canceling an upcoming Google Calendar event no longer prevents new calendar events from being displayed and no longer causes an exception error to appear in the logs.

GS-4210 and GS-4200

When a VidyoRoom system joins a day-long meeting via a Google Calendar invitation, the VidyoRoom system is now able to reliably disconnect from the call.

GS-4205

VidyoRoom HD-230 systems no longer freeze when certain peripheral devices are plugged into the USB 2.0 ports.

GS-4198

If a Google Calendar receives an invitation to only one instance of a recurring meeting, the VidyoRoom systems now display the invitation to that single instance.

GS-4195

When viewing Google Calendar meetings on a VidyoRoom system, the meetings no longer flash momentarily.

GS-4194,

GS-4118,

GS-3775,

GS-3252,

and GS-3718

An issue where the VidyoRemote 3 periodically lost connection to the VidyoRoom system, which in some cases also made it appear as if the VidyoRoom system was randomly going offline and then back online again, has been resolved.

GS-4176

VidyoRoom systems configured with Google Calendar no longer occasionally display some meetings in duplicate.

GS-4098

VidyoRoom systems no longer get disconnected from calls when the Mute button is pressed on AVer VC520/V8U0B speakerphones.
